如何连接ArcGIS 数据库? (arcgis 数据库连接)
ArcGIS 数据库是一个非常重要的数据库,它可以帮助我们管理和处理空间数据。但是,连接ArcGIS 数据库并不是一件容易的事情。本文将介绍如何连接ArcGIS 数据库,包括以下几个方面:
1. 确定数据库类型
2. 确定连接方式
3. 配置连接信息
4. 连接数据库
一、确定数据库类型
连接ArcGIS数据库之前首先需要知道你的数据库类型。常见的数据库类型包括:Oracle、SQL Server、PostgreSQL等。如果不确定数据库类型,可以通过以下方法来查看。
Oracle 数据库类型:
oracle.jpg
打开“开始”菜单,搜索并打开“SQL Plus”,输入用户名和密码,回车登录。如果可以成功登录,则说明数据库类型为Oracle。
SQL Server 数据库类型:
sqlserver.jpg
打开“开始”菜单,搜索并打开“SQL Server Management Studio”,输入用户名和密码,回车登录。如果可以成功登录,则说明数据库类型为SQL Server。
PostgreSQL 数据库类型:
postgresql.jpg
打开“开始”菜单,搜索并打开“pgAdmin 4”,输入用户名和密码,回车登录。如果可以成功登录,则说明数据库类型为PostgreSQL。
二、确定连接方式
在确定数据库类型之后,需要选择正确的连接方式。常见的连接方式包括:
1.直接连接(Direct Connection):直接连接数据库服务器进行操作
2.通过服务(Through Service):通过ArcGIS Server提供的服务连接数据库
直接连接适用于在安装了空间数据库管理系统的情况下,通过网络访问空间数据库。通过服务适用于需要访问远程数据库或使用访问控制的情况。
三、配置连接信息
无论是直接连接还是通过服务连接,都需要配置连接信息,以便ArcGIS软件与数据库交互。在ArcCatalog(或ArcMap)中,右键单击数据库连接目录,选择“新建连接”。
1.直接连接
直接连接需要填写详细的连接信息,包括连接类型、数据库名、服务器名和网络协议等。具体配置步骤如下:
Step 1: 填写连接名称和连接类型
configure_1.png
在打开的“新建连接”窗口中,输入连接名称(Connection Name)和选择连接类型(Connection Type)。
Step 2: 填写服务器名和端口号
configure_2.png
在“服务器类型”标签下,选择相应的数据库类型,输入服务器名(Server Name)和端口号。可以在“浏览”按钮中选择从服务器列表中选择。对于Oracle数据库,可以使用Oracle Wallet来存储数据库凭证。
Step 3: 输入数据库信息
configure_3.png
在“常规”标签下,输入数据库名称(Database)和用户名/密码(User Name/Password)。可以选择“保存密码”选项,在下次连接时自动填入正确的密码。
Step 4: 测试连接
configure_4.png
单击“测试连接”按钮以测试连接是否正常。如果连接成功,就可以单击“OK”按钮并保存连接信息。
2.通过服务
通过服务连接需要提供服务的URL、用户名和密码。具体配置步骤如下:
Step 1: 填写服务名称和类型
configure_5.png
在打开的“新建连接”窗口中,输入连接名称(Connection Name)和选择连接类型(Connection Type)。
Step 2: 填写服务URL
configure_6.png
在“网络”标签下,输入服务URL(URL)。
Step 3: 输入用户名和密码
configure_7.png
在“常规”标签下,输入用户名(User Name)和密码(Password)。可以选择“保存密码”选项,在下次连接时自动填入正确的密码。
Step 4: 测试连接
configure_8.png
单击“测试连接”按钮以测试连接是否正常。如果连接成功,就可以单击“OK”按钮并保存连接信息。
四、连接数据库
配置连接信息后,就可以开启连接ArcGIS数据库了。在ArcCatalog(或ArcMap)中,选择数据库连接目录,右键单击,并选择“连接”选项,即可连接到数据库。
连接ArcGIS数据库需要正确的数据库类型、连接方式和连接信息,通过正确的配置和连接,可以方便地管理和处理空间数据。希望本文可以帮助你更好地连接ArcGIS数据库。